FromSoftware and Bandai Namco have released a gripping 10-minute overview trailer for Elden Ring: Nightreign, a standalone co-op survival action spinoff set in the revered Elden Ring universe. Premiered on May 2, 2025, the trailer showcases the game’s dynamic world, innovative mechanics, and cooperative gameplay, building anticipation for its May 30, 2025, release on PlayStation 4, PlayStation 5, Xbox One, Xbox Series X|S, and PC.
The trailer plunges players into Limveld, a reimagined, procedurally generated version of Elden Ring’s Limgrave. Once a thriving land under divine influence, Limveld is now a perilous landscape on the verge of collapse, featuring shifting terrain, random boss encounters, and environmental threats like meteor strikes. This roguelite structure ensures each run is unique, offering endless replayability. The trailer emphasizes the game’s cooperative core, designed for squads of three, though a solo mode is available. It highlights teamwork-driven mechanics, such as reviving fallen allies by attacking them, adding a fresh twist to FromSoftware’s signature challenge.
Elden Ring: Nightreign introduces eight distinct Nightfarer classes, each with unique weapons, passive abilities, and skills. The trailer showcases diverse playstyles, from a grappling hook-wielding class to a stealth-based Nightfarer capable of invisibility. Players will face the Nightlords, formidable bosses tied to the game’s three-day-and-night cycle, alongside familiar enemies from Elden Ring and Dark Souls, including a boss resembling Astel, Naturalborn of the Void, and another akin to Godfrey. Nostalgic touches, like armor sets inspired by Dark Souls’ Solaire of Astora, have sparked excitement among fans, as seen in enthusiastic posts on social media.
The trailer also teases robust character customization and a world that evolves with each playthrough, reinforcing FromSoftware’s reputation for depth and difficulty. What is Elden Ring: Nightreign about?
Bandai Namco Entertainment's official description for Elden Ring: Nightreign reads:
Teaming up in squads of three – or daring to go solo – players must choose one of eight Nightfarers, each with different abilities, to outlast a three day-and-night cycle. Players must make split-second decisions about combat and exploration across a map that can fluctuate with different biomes, weapons, and enemies in order to become stronger, and outrun the encroaching circle of fire to be able to take on terrifying bosses at the end of each day. This culminates on the third day, where if players were successful in surviving the night must take on one of the Nightlords – new bosses for this version. Nightfarers must learn to cooperate to take down these challenges, combining their unique abilities together for an unparalleled experience in the ELDEN RING universe. All is not lost for those who fall in defeat. Unsuccessful runs will grant players relics to allow them to customize and upgrade their characters tailored to their personal play styles.
